TheChampsTag! [aka - WEIRDEST TAG EVER!]

show more
Upvotes (4)
Comments (1)
Sorted by:
  • BenjiJames reply After watching this again for the first time in ages, i decided to upload it here so that some of you join in on this tag for yourself :) It was definitely one of the most random set of questions i've ever gotten hahaha!! However, sadly, Becca has within the past year, Becca has chosen to take down her channel to pursue a stage acting and comedy career :) Good on her! @Wolfer -- would love to see a response from you, dude :D
Download the Vidme app!